Q: Is 101,610,609 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 101,610,609 is a composite number.

Why is 101,610,609 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 101,610,609 can be evenly divided by 1 3 727 2,181 46,589 139,767 33,870,203 and 101,610,609, with no remainder.

Since 101,610,609 cannot be divided by just 1 and 101,610,609, it is a composite number.
